PCR recycled plastic offers a sustainable solution by transforming post-consumer waste into high-quality materials, addressing environmental concerns while supporting diverse industries.
PCR stands for post-consumer recycled plastic, which is produced from plastics that have been used and discarded by consumers. This innovative recycling process not only reduces the amount of waste in landfills but also conserves natural resources by reusing existing materials.
With plastic pollution growing, over 300 million tons of plastic are produced annually, according to the Plastic Pollution Coalition. Transitioning to PCR recycled plastic can significantly reduce our carbon footprint and reliance on virgin plastics, aligning with global sustainability goals.
Companies like Coca-Cola are leading the way by incorporating PCR recycled plastic into their bottles. Coca-Cola aims to use 50% recycled content in its bottles by 2030, showcasing how businesses can effectively address sustainability challenges while enhancing brand reputation.
PCR recycled plastic is versatile and can be used in various sectors, including packaging, construction, and automotive. For example, brands like Unilever are currently using PCR materials in their product packaging to minimize waste and enhance eco-friendliness.
Despite its benefits, the adoption of PCR recycled plastic faces challenges, including quality variability and availability. However, advancements in recycling technologies are continuously improving these aspects, making PCR materials more reliable and easier to integrate into production processes.

PCR plastic is made from recycled materials, specifically used plastic products, whereas virgin plastic is produced directly from fossil fuels and has never been used before.
By reducing the demand for virgin plastics, businesses can lower production costs and create new jobs within the recycling industry, contributing positively to the economy.
While PCR recycled plastic is suitable for many applications, its use may be limited in products that require high purity standards or specific aesthetic qualities.
Yes, PCR recycled plastic can typically be recycled multiple times, although the quality may degrade after several cycles.
